description The article presents a new set of the accreditation criteria for engineering and technology educational programs approved and implemented by the Association for Engineering Education of Russia (AEER) since 2014. The criteria were developed in accordance with Russian professional standards, Federal State Educational Standards, as well as international standards such as EUR-ACE Framework Standards and Guidelines and IEA Graduate Attributes and Professional Competencies. In 2014-2015 the AEER accreditation criteria were piloted by the accreditation of engineering technicians and master degree programs offered by Russian universities and technical schools / colleges. The results of the criteria piloting are described and analyzed. The objectives for the development of Russian national accreditation system for educational programs in engineering and technology are defined, which include integration in internationally recognized structures such as European Network for Accreditation of Engineering Education (ENAEE) and International Engineering Alliance (IEA).
